Size: a a a

2020 April 07

AT

Andrey Torlopov in SwiftBook
Александр Ниткин
У меня к вам вопрос, почему можно использовать только let а не var например
в конструкции  if let ?
источник

АН

Александр Ниткин... in SwiftBook
Andrey Torlopov
в конструкции  if let ?
да я переделывал ругается
источник

AT

Andrey Torlopov in SwiftBook
if var по идеи можно указывать. переменная будет изменяемой.
источник

🅰Б

🅰️лександр Б.... in SwiftBook
Александр Ниткин
У меня к вам вопрос, почему можно использовать только let а не var например
Это конструкция для опционального связывания, она извлекает опционал
источник

🅰Б

🅰️лександр Б.... in SwiftBook
var тоже можно
источник

АН

Александр Ниткин... in SwiftBook
🅰️лександр Б.
var тоже можно
ругается var raz1:Any=12
var raz2:Any=8


if var ra1=raz1 as? Int, var ra2=raz2 as? Int{
 print(ra1+ra2)
} else{
 print("zero")
}
источник

АН

Александр Ниткин... in SwiftBook
🅰️лександр Б.
var тоже можно
Swift version 5.0.1 (swift-5.0.1-RELEASE)
 swiftc -o main main.swift
main.swift:6:8: warning: variable 'ra1' was never mutated; consider changing to 'let' constant
if var ra1=raz1 as? Int, var ra2=raz2 as? Int{
  ~~~ ^
  let
main.swift:6:30: warning: variable 'ra2' was never mutated; consider changing to 'let' constant
if var ra1=raz1 as? Int, var ra2=raz2 as? Int{
                        ~~~ ^
                        let
 ./main
20
источник

AT

Andrey Torlopov in SwiftBook
Александр Ниткин
ругается var raz1:Any=12
var raz2:Any=8


if var ra1=raz1 as? Int, var ra2=raz2 as? Int{
 print(ra1+ra2)
} else{
 print("zero")
}
все вроде пашет.
источник

A

Alexandr✔️ in SwiftBook
Александр Ниткин
Swift version 5.0.1 (swift-5.0.1-RELEASE)
 swiftc -o main main.swift
main.swift:6:8: warning: variable 'ra1' was never mutated; consider changing to 'let' constant
if var ra1=raz1 as? Int, var ra2=raz2 as? Int{
  ~~~ ^
  let
main.swift:6:30: warning: variable 'ra2' was never mutated; consider changing to 'let' constant
if var ra1=raz1 as? Int, var ra2=raz2 as? Int{
                        ~~~ ^
                        let
 ./main
20
а где комплируется код?
источник

🅰Б

🅰️лександр Б.... in SwiftBook
Он не ругается, это ворнинг что Ты создашеь переменную но не используешь в коде нигде и предлагает сделать из нее константу
источник

VO

Vitaly Okhrimenko in SwiftBook
что делать если переходишь из прилы в настройки чтобы изменить настройки приватности, типа доступ к календарю, возвращаешься назад, а аппа перезагружается с новыми privacy, что делать в таком случае кто знает?)
источник

АН

Александр Ниткин... in SwiftBook
Alexandr✔️
а где комплируется код?
источник

A

Alexandr✔️ in SwiftBook
здесь с ворнингами, видимо, не скомпилируется
источник

RK

Rustem Kz in SwiftBook
куда исчез курс ichat в списке курсов?
источник

RK

Rustem Kz in SwiftBook
источник

🅰Б

🅰️лександр Б.... in SwiftBook
Видимо переделывают
источник

AT

Andrey Torlopov in SwiftBook
у вас что-то с браузером не так...
источник

o

oureternaltime in SwiftBook
У вас тоже не работают курсы?
источник

RK

Rustem Kz in SwiftBook
Andrey Torlopov
у вас что-то с браузером не так...
уменьшил
источник

AT

Andrey Torlopov in SwiftBook
да. iChat куда-то пропал. Но появится, я думаю.
источник